(字符串)较大分组位置

图片说明

/**
 * @param {string} s
 * @return {number[][]}
 */
var largeGroupPositions = function(s) {
    var result = [];
    var start = 0;
    var end = 1;
    while(s[end]){
        while(s[end] == s[start]){
            end++
        }
        if(end - start >=3){
            result.push([start,end-1])
        }
        start = end;
        end = start + 1;
    }
    return result;
};
其他算法 文章被收录于专栏

其他算法

全部评论

相关推荐

不愿透露姓名的神秘牛友
07-09 12:30
点赞 评论 收藏
分享
05-24 14:12
门头沟学院 Java
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务